I do not think a Rigo-Kiko is going to happen in the short term.
If Scott Quigg beats Yoandris Salinas, there will be a unification fight between Scott and Kiko in London. Kiko has a name in the UK and would receive the biggest payday of its career.
Today there was even a tweet from Eddie Hearn stating they are already in talks with Kiko's promoters.
